Overview
The ANELLO X3 is the world's smallest and lightest 3-Axis high performance optical gyroscope IMU. It leverages three state-of-the-art ANELLO SiPhOG units as low-noise and low-drift optical smart sensors, each with its own independent 6-Axis redundant IMU sensor. It features triple redundant 6-Axis MEMS IMUs (18 axes total), patented photonic integrated circuit technology, and ASIL-D ready safety rated RTOS and CPU. With < 0.5°/hr gyro bias instability and < 0.05°/√hr angular random walk, it is designed for autonomous applications in land, air and sea.
